В данной теме обсуждаются CPU линейки AMD Ryzen 3X00 (микроархитектура ZEN2)!

Статистика разгона Zen 2 систем >> https://docs.google.com/spreadsheets/d/ ... sp=sharing

Для запуска процессоров 3X00 требуется биос с поддержкой AM4 Combo PI 0.0.7.2A - обновляйте заранее перед установкой процессора самостоятельно или в сервисном центре.

Возьмите себе за правило, с каждым биосом переустаналивать чипсет драйвера. Технология CPPC2 довольно требовательная к согласованию работы Windows и BIOS. Ввиду того что экосистема BIOS не способна подстроиться под Windows - это нужно делать вручную путем деинсталляции чипсета драйвера и установки с каждым обновлением SMU.

lameover писал(а):
некоторые отыскивают какие-то интересные способы, после которых у них вольтаж до 0.9 опускается и гигагерцы до 2.2

При сбалансированном плане эл.питания(не тот что от AMD, а стандартный от винды) проц начинает сбрасывать вольтаж и частоты, но при мало мальской нагрузке частоты подлетают ровно как и вольтаж.

Собрал сегодня 3600 с gigabyte x579 aorus elite. Пока поставил боксовый кулер. В тестах и играх (батла5 и апекс) одно ядро прогревается до80-86 градусов (странно, что такая разница, градусов 40 на одно ядро, другие до 48 и ниже), остальные существенно меньше греются (дома очень жарко сегодня). Память 2×8 ballistix завелась на xmp профиле без проблем 3200 16.18.18.36, разогнал до 3600 на этих же таймингах, 3600 на таймингах 16.16.16.34 не поехали. Виграх особой разницы с 3930k не заметил, но играл в 4к, точно хуже не стало. Винда завелась сразу, еще ничего не переустанавливал. Поставил обновление винды и режим сбалансированный (темпы на раб столе упали, сейчас показывает 55 самое горячее и 32 самое холодные ядра).
